Key Elements of a Great News Poster
Alright, now that we know the benefits of templates, let's talk about what makes a great news poster. Even with a template, you'll need to make sure you have the right elements in place. First up is your headline. Make it bold, clear, and attention-grabbing. Your headline is the first thing people will see, so make it count! Next, include a concise summary of the news. Keep it brief and to the point. People need to know the essentials quickly. Images are super important! Choose high-quality images that are relevant to your news. A picture is worth a thousand words, right? Make sure to include the date, time, and location of the event or news item. Don't forget your contact information. Include a way for people to get in touch with you if they want more details. Finally, ensure your poster has a clear call to action. Tell people what you want them to do! Whether it's to attend an event, visit a website, or call a number, make it obvious. The more clear these elements are, the better your poster will do!
Compelling Headlines and Concise Summaries
Your headline is your first and often only chance to grab attention. It needs to be bold, clear, and immediately relevant to the audience. Think of it as the hook that draws people in. Use strong action verbs and compelling language to create interest. Keep your headline concise, ideally within a few words, to ensure it's easily readable at a glance. Following the headline, your summary should provide essential information quickly. Get straight to the point: what is the news, why is it important, and who is affected? Aim for brevity. The goal is to provide enough context to pique interest without overwhelming the reader. Bullet points can be extremely useful here, as they allow for quick consumption of information. A well-crafted headline and a concise summary work hand-in-hand to ensure that your message is both attention-grabbing and informative.

Essential Contact Information and Call to Action
Always include essential details: date, time, and location for events or announcements. Make sure this information is prominently displayed and easy to find. Provide accurate contact information so interested readers can reach out for more information. This might be a phone number, email address, or website. Your call to action is the final step: tell your audience what you want them to do. Do you want them to attend an event, visit a website, or make a purchase? Be clear and direct. Place your call to action in a prominent spot and use action-oriented language to encourage engagement. This final step is crucial to driving the desired outcome and ensuring that your news poster effectively conveys its purpose. Content and Message Alignment
Your content should drive your design choices. Think about what message you are trying to convey and choose a template that supports this effectively. Does your news require a lot of text, or is it more visual? If you have a lot of information to share, select a template with ample space for text, such as a layout that incorporates clear sections and headings. If your message is more visually-oriented, choose a template that emphasizes images and graphics. Ensure that the template you choose allows for your content to be presented in a clear, organized, and engaging manner.
